如何往服务器里放数据
-
往服务器中放数据是一个常见的操作,可以通过以下几种方法实现:
-
使用HTTP协议发送数据:可以使用常见的网络库(如Python中的requests库)来发送HTTP请求,并在请求中添加需要放入服务器的数据。通常使用POST方法来发送数据,将数据作为请求体的一部分发送到服务器。服务器接收到请求后,可以使用相应的后端技术(如PHP、Java、Node.js等)来处理请求并将数据存入数据库或其他持久化存储系统中。
-
使用FTP上传数据:FTP(文件传输协议)是一种用于在网络上进行文件传输的协议。可以使用FTP客户端软件连接到服务器,并将需要上传的数据通过GUI或命令行界面上传到服务器指定的目录中。服务器需要运行FTP服务器软件以接收并存储上传的数据。
-
使用数据库连接:如果服务器上运行了数据库服务器,可以使用数据库连接来将数据存储在数据库中。可以使用相应编程语言提供的数据库连接库(如Python中的MySQLdb、pymysql库)来连接到数据库服务器,并执行插入操作将数据存入数据库表中。
-
使用云存储服务:如果你使用的是云服务器,通常云服务提供商会提供相应的存储服务。可以使用提供的API调用来将数据存储在云存储服务中,如AWS S3、阿里云OSS等。
需要注意的是,无论使用哪种方法,都需要确保服务器具有相应的权限来接收和存储数据。另外,为了数据的安全性和一致性,建议在服务器端实现相应的数据验证和处理逻辑,以避免非法数据的存入。
1年前 -
-
要向服务器中存储数据,可以通过以下几种方式:
-
使用HTTP请求:可以通过编写客户端程序,使用HTTP请求将数据发送给服务器的特定端点。常见的HTTP请求方法包括GET、POST、PUT和DELETE。使用POST方法可以向服务器发送包含数据的请求,服务器将该数据存储在指定的位置。使用PUT方法可以上传文件或将数据存储在服务器上。使用GET方法可以从服务器中检索数据。使用DELETE方法可以从服务器中删除数据。
-
使用数据库:服务器端通常会使用数据库来存储和管理数据。可以通过与数据库建立连接并执行SQL语句来向数据库中插入数据。常用的数据库管理系统包括MySQL、SQL Server、Oracle等。通过编写服务器端程序,可以通过数据库的API来插入数据。
-
使用文件传输:可以通过服务器上的文件传输协议(如FTP、SFTP等)来向服务器中传输数据。通过编写客户端程序,将数据上传到服务器上的特定文件夹中,服务器端将数据保存在相应的文件中。
-
使用WebSocket协议:WebSocket协议提供了双向通信的功能,可以实时地将数据发送到服务器并存储。可以通过编写客户端程序使用WebSocket协议与服务器建立连接,并将数据发送给服务器。
-
使用第三方API:一些服务器上提供了API接口,可以通过HTTP请求向这些API发送数据,并将数据存储到服务器中。例如,可以使用Google Drive API将数据存储到Google云端硬盘中。
无论使用哪种方式,都需要确保服务器端有相应的接口或服务来接收数据,并进行存储和管理。同时还需要考虑数据的安全性和合规性,确保数据传输过程中的安全性和数据的完整性。
1年前 -
-
往服务器里放数据的操作流程包括以下几个步骤:
- 选择服务器:首先需要选择一台适合的服务器。根据需求,可以选择虚拟主机、共享主机或独立服务器等不同类型的服务器。
- 连接服务器:通过远程连接工具(如SSH)连接服务器。通常需要提供主机地址、用户名和密码等信息进行连接。
- 上传数据:一旦连接成功,就可以通过各种方法将数据上传到服务器上。
以下是几种常见的上传数据到服务器的方法:
使用FTP客户端上传数据:
- 下载并安装FTP客户端软件(如FileZilla);
- 打开FTP客户端,输入服务器IP地址、用户名和密码来连接服务器;
- 导航到服务器上的目标文件夹,将需要上传的数据拖放到目标文件夹中。
使用SSH上传数据:
- 打开终端或命令提示符,输入以下命令连接到服务器:
ssh username@server_ip,其中username是用户名,server_ip是服务器IP地址; - 输入密码以完成连接;
- 使用
scp命令将数据上传到服务器,例如:scp local_file username@server_ip:remote_folder,其中local_file是本地文件路径,remote_folder是服务器上的目标文件夹路径。
使用Web文件管理器上传数据:
- 一些服务器提供Web文件管理器,可以通过Web浏览器访问服务器并上传数据。连接到服务器的Web管理器后,找到上传文件的选项,并选择需要上传的文件。
使用版本控制系统上传数据:
- 使用版本控制系统(如Git)将数据上传到服务器。在本地计算机上初始化版本控制仓库并将数据提交到仓库中,在服务器上克隆仓库以获得上传的数据。
无论使用哪种方法,上传数据后确保数据的完整性和安全性,并记得备份数据以防止意外情况发生。
1年前